Helms, Jesse [R-NC] NC R H000463 0 International Television Broadcasting Act of 2000 - Sets forth the purposes of this Act, including to: (1) require the establishment of a new international television service under the Broadcasting Board of Governors to replace Worldnet and VOA-TV; and (2) ensure that international television broadcasts of the United States effectively and accurately represent the United States and its policies.Establishes the International Television Service within the International Broadcasting Bureau. Sets forth programming of the Television Service, including: (1) those programs which were produced by the Office of Policy of the Bureau before enactment of this Act; and (2) such additional programs relating to U.S. policies as the Director of Policy of the Bureau may develop.Terminates Worldnet and VOA-TV. 2025-08-20T14:18:58Z
